Obverse lettering جمهورية مصر العربية خمسة جنيهات ١٤٠٠ ١٩٨٠
(Translation: Arab Republic of Egypt 5 Pounds 1980 1400)
Reverse description The reverse features a central device depicting the seated statue of Imhotep, the ancient Egyptian physician and polymath, shown in three-quarter view upon a plinth inscribed with the date '18 March' in Arabic. Imhotep holds a staff in his right hand, with a crescent-and-bowl medical symbol and a stack of bricks to his left, and a cartouche bearing the name of Allah above. Surrounding the central motif, Arabic inscriptions in the field read 'For the construction of Qasr Al-Aini' arcing to the upper left, with 'Day of the Egyptian Physician' appearing along the lower arc. The design is enclosed within a segmented inner border matching that of the obverse.
